Holiday Retail Sales to Hit $1 Trillion Amid Caution

Story summary
  • National Retail Federation (NRF) forecasts holiday retail sales will rise 3.7% to 4.2% and reach $1.01 trillion to $1.02 trillion.
  • NRF President Matthew Shay notes consumer spending remains strong, driven by gift purchases, despite tariffs, inflation, and a shutdown.
  • Retailers are expected to hire fewer seasonal workers this year, between 265,000 and 365,000, down from 442,000 in 2024.
  • Consumers are more price-sensitive, prioritizing gifts and cutting back on nonessential items.
